Is there a firewall in Windows 2000 Prof. that can be turned off or disabled?
I have a user that connects to our network remotely (via VPN). Everything
was working fine until she downloaded windows updates onto her machine. She
has a good internet and VPN client connection, so why can't her machine
communicate with our network?

Any advice would be great. Thanks.

No native firewall in Windows 2000
